Respondent-appellant having applied for permission to proceed as a poor person and for assignment of counsel on the appeal taken herein from an order of the Family Court, Oneida County, entered November 1, 2021,
Now, upon reading and filing the papers with respect to the application, and due deliberation having been had thereon,
It is hereby ORDERED that the application is denied, with leave to renew upon the filing and service of a motion that includes, among other things, an affidavit setting forth appellant's gross monthly income from all sources, assets with their value, and financial obligations.
